Israel launches tenth wave of strikes on Iranian targets
The Israeli military said it has launched a tenth wave of large-scale strikes on Iranian regime infrastructure in Tehran, continuing its campaign against key command and military sites as the conflict intensifies.
According to the Israeli Defense Forces (IDF), the attacks are aimed at regime command centres and strategic military infrastructure in the Iranian capital. The latest operation comes amid escalating exchanges between Israel and Iran, with both sides carrying out missile and drone attacks across the region in recent days.
2026-03-04 13:56CIA evacuates stations within range of Iranian missiles: Reports
The CIA has reportedly ordered the evacuation of its stations located within range of Iranian ballistic missiles following a drone strike on its facility at the US Embassy in Riyadh. According to reports, Iranian drones hit the embassy compound, causing structural damage. There has been no official confirmation from US authorities regarding broader evacuation orders.
2026-03-04 13:55Iran claims missile strike destroyed key US radar in Gulf
Iran says it destroyed the AN/FPS-132 radar at Al Udeid with a missile strike, a system used to guide Patriot and THAAD air-defence systems in the Gulf.
The reported attack comes amid escalating tensions in the region. Concerns have also grown over maritime security in the Strait of Hormuz, with energy markets reacting sharply to the developments.
2026-03-04 13:26US–Israeli strikes hit Bushehr airport, aircraft reportedly destroyed
US–Israeli strikes have damaged an airport in the southern Iranian port city of Bushehr, which is also home to a nuclear power plant, Iran’s Mehr news agency reported. According to an AFP report cited by the agency, a projectile struck an Airbus aircraft during the attack, completely destroying the plane. The blast’s shockwave also caused damage to the airport terminal. Officials said a second aircraft was also hit in the strike. The full extent of damage or disruption to airport operations was not immediately clear. The reported attack comes as military exchanges between Iran and Israel continue to escalate, raising concerns about strikes near sensitive infrastructure in the region.
2026-03-04 13:22Iran to hold state funeral for Supreme Leader Khamenei
Iran will hold a state funeral for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ei on Wednesday evening, according to state television, as the country continues nationwide mourning following confirmation of his death earlier this week. Authorities said public ceremonies will allow mourners to pay their respects, with large gatherings expected as the country marks the passing of the leader who ruled Iran for more than three decades.
2026-03-04 12:04Israel evacuates some embassy staff from UAE after alleged Iran-linked plots
Israel has quietly evacuated non-essential staff from its embassy in the United Arab Emirates after two suspected Iran-linked plots targeting its diplomatic mission were foiled, an Israeli official said. According to a senior official cited by Channel 12, the alleged attempts were part of a broader effort to target Israeli diplomats. Thousands of Israelis remain in the UAE, including tourists stranded due to cancelled flights, residents and dual nationals seeking assistance to leave as regional tensions escalate. Since the conflict began on Saturday, the UAE has reportedly faced more than 800 drone attacks and 200 missile strikes, according to the country’s defence ministry.
2026-03-04 11:38NYC Mayor Mamdani condemns Iranian repression, cautions against regime-change war
New York City Mayor Zohran Mamdani has criticised Iran’s leadership over alleged human rights abuses while warning against military intervention aimed at regime change. Commenting on rising tensions in the Middle East, Mamdani described the Iranian government as “brutal” and accused it of carrying out systematic repression, including the killing of thousands of protesters earlier this year. At the same time, he cautioned that past US-led regime-change wars in the region had led to devastating consequences, urging policymakers to avoid another prolonged conflict as tensions escalate.
2026-03-04 11:33SpiceJet to operate special UAE flights to bring stranded Indians home
SpiceJet will run eight special flights from Fujairah in the UAE on March 4 to bring stranded Indian nationals back to the country. The services include four flights to Delhi, three to Mumbai and one to Kochi. The airline had earlier operated four similar flights on March 3 to help passengers affected by the ongoing disruptions.
2026-03-04 11:32Drone targets US embassy support camp near Baghdad airport
A drone struck a logistical support camp linked to the US embassy near Baghdad International Airport, Al Jazeera Arabic reported. There were no immediate details on casualties or damage. The incident comes amid heightened tensions in the region and growing security concerns around US diplomatic and military facilities in Iraq.
2026-03-04 11:04“I defy anybody to justify this”: Mary Trump on graves of 165 Iranian schoolchildren
Mary L. Trump, niece of US President Donald Trump, condemned the deaths of 165 schoolgirls in Iran after recent US–Israel strikes, saying, “I defy anybody to justify this.” The schoolgirls from Minab Primary School in southern Iran were killed on Saturday and buried on Tuesday. Due to the scale, their 165 graves were dug by bulldozers. Widely shared images of the funeral have been described as some of the most heartbreaking of the conflict.
2026-03-04 11:00UK suspends student visas for four countries over asylum misuse concerns
The UK government has immediately suspended certain visa routes for nationals from four countries, citing concerns over alleged misuse of the asylum system. Home Secretary Shabana Mahmood said student visas for applicants from Afghanistan, Cameroon, Myanmar and Sudan have been halted. In addition, work visas for Afghan nationals have also been suspended. The Home Office described the move as “unprecedented”, saying it is aimed at preventing individuals from using visa routes to enter the UK before claiming asylum.
